What is SaaS Investment Banking?
SaaS investment banking is a cloud-based platform that allows financial institutions to manage their investments and transactions online. This technology enables banks to streamline their operations, reduce costs, and improve efficiency. Through SaaS investment banking, financial institutions can access real-time information, automate tasks, and make well-informed investment choices.

Challenges of SaaS Investment Banking
While SaaS investment banking offers many benefits, there are also some challenges associated with this technology. Data security is a primary challenge. Financial institutions need to guarantee the security and protection of their data from cyber threats. Additionally, banks must comply with regulatory requirements when using SaaS investment banking, which can be complex and time-consuming.
